Meaning of "reeducation camps"

reeducation camps: These are facilities where individuals are detained and subjected to intensive programs aimed at altering their beliefs, attitudes, or behaviors. The term is often associated with coercive or authoritarian regimes that seek to indoctrinate or control dissidents or perceived enemies
